溫馨提示×

分布式云服務(wù)如何應(yīng)對大規(guī)模擴展

小樊
81
2024-10-24 14:37:55
欄目: 云計算

分布式云服務(wù)通過一系列技術(shù)和架構(gòu)設(shè)計,有效應(yīng)對大規(guī)模擴展的挑戰(zhàn),確保系統(tǒng)的性能、可擴展性和可靠性。以下是分布式云服務(wù)應(yīng)對大規(guī)模擴展的關(guān)鍵技術(shù)和策略:

分布式云服務(wù)應(yīng)對大規(guī)模擴展的關(guān)鍵技術(shù)和策略

  • 虛擬化技術(shù):通過虛擬化技術(shù),如VMware、KVM、Hyper-V等,將物理資源抽象和隔離,為云平臺提供彈性的資源分配和管理能力。
  • 容器技術(shù):利用容器技術(shù),如Docker和Kubernetes,實現(xiàn)應(yīng)用的快速部署、跨平臺移植和彈性擴展。
  • 分布式存儲與計算:通過分布式存儲系統(tǒng),如Hadoop HDFS、Ceph等,實現(xiàn)數(shù)據(jù)的高可靠性和高可擴展性。
  • 負載均衡:使用負載均衡技術(shù),如RabbitMQ集群,將任務(wù)均勻分配給各個節(jié)點,提高系統(tǒng)整體的性能和穩(wěn)定性。
  • 數(shù)據(jù)復(fù)制與分區(qū):通過數(shù)據(jù)復(fù)制和分區(qū),提高數(shù)據(jù)的可用性和并行處理能力。
  • 自動化部署與彈性伸縮:利用自動化部署工具和彈性伸縮服務(wù),根據(jù)業(yè)務(wù)需求動態(tài)調(diào)整計算資源。
  • 容錯與高可用性設(shè)計:通過數(shù)據(jù)冗余、故障檢測與恢復(fù)等技術(shù)手段,確保系統(tǒng)的穩(wěn)定性和可靠性。

分布式云服務(wù)大規(guī)模擴展的挑戰(zhàn)

  • 性能瓶頸:隨著服務(wù)器規(guī)模的擴大,如何保持高性能是一個挑戰(zhàn)。
  • 資源限制:物理資源的限制可能會影響到系統(tǒng)的擴展性。
  • 擴展性受限:云服務(wù)提供商的策略可能會限制用戶的服務(wù)器規(guī)模。

分布式云服務(wù)大規(guī)模擴展的解決方案

  • 優(yōu)化應(yīng)用設(shè)計:通過優(yōu)化應(yīng)用設(shè)計和代碼,減少資源占用,提高性能。
  • 選擇合適的云服務(wù)提供商:選擇具有更強擴展性和資源支持的云服務(wù)提供商。
  • 使用容器技術(shù):通過容器技術(shù),實現(xiàn)資源的隔離和動態(tài)管理,提高資源利用率和擴展性。

通過上述技術(shù)和策略,分布式云服務(wù)能夠有效應(yīng)對大規(guī)模擴展的挑戰(zhàn),確保系統(tǒng)的性能、可擴展性和可靠性,滿足不斷增長的業(yè)務(wù)需求。

0